def activestate(self):
|
||||
"""
|
||||
ActiveState contains a state value that reflects whether the unit is
|
||||
currently active or not. The following states are currently defined:
|
||||
active, reloading, inactive, failed, activating, deactivating. active
|
||||
indicates that unit is active (obviously...). reloading indicates
|
||||
that the unit is active and currently reloading its configuration.
|
||||
inactive indicates that it is inactive and the previous run was
|
||||
successful or no previous run has taken place yet. failed indicates
|
||||
that it is inactive and the previous run was not successful (more
|
||||
information about the reason for this is available on the unit type
|
||||
specific interfaces, for example for services in the Result property,
|
||||
see below). activating indicates that the unit has previously been
|
||||
inactive but is currently in the process of entering an active state.
|
||||
Conversely deactivating indicates that the unit is currently in the
|
||||
process of deactivation.
|
||||
"""

def substate(self):
|
||||
"""
|
||||
SubState encodes states of the same state machine that ActiveState
|
||||
covers, but knows more fine-grained states that are unit-type-specific.
|
||||
Where ActiveState only covers six high-level states, SubState covers
|
||||
possibly many more low-level unit-type-specific states that are mapped
|
||||
to the six high-level states. Note that multiple low-level states might
|
||||
map to the same high-level state, but not vice versa. Not all
|
||||
high-level states have low-level counterparts on all unit types. At
|
||||
this point the low-level states are not documented here, and are more
|
||||
likely to be extended later on than the common high-level states
|
||||
explained above.
|
||||
"""
